Platelet-rich plasma (PRP) and platelet-rich fibrin (PRF) are both regenerative treatments prepared from a small sample of your own blood. Both concentrate platelets and naturally occurring growth factors that can support tissue repair, collagen production, and skin rejuvenation. The primary difference lies in how the blood is processed and the resulting composition of the treatment.
PRP is a liquid platelet concentrate typically prepared using an anticoagulant to prevent the blood from clotting during processing. Its liquid consistency makes it versatile for treatments such as injections, microneedling, and hair restoration.
PRF is prepared without an added anticoagulant and allows a natural fibrin network to form. This fibrin matrix can help hold platelets and growth factors within the treatment area and provides a scaffold that supports a more gradual release of platelet-derived growth factors.
Neither treatment is universally “better.” The choice between PRP and PRF depends on the treatment area, the procedure being performed, and your individual goals. Your Vega Vitality provider will recommend the most appropriate option as part of your personalized treatment plan.
PRF Gel takes the regenerative concept a step further by creating a thicker, gel-like preparation that can provide subtle structural support in addition to the regenerative benefits associated with platelet- and fibrin-based treatments. This makes it particularly useful in areas where both skin quality and volume are concerns, such as the under-eye area.

To decrease the risk of bruising, we recommend avoiding the following for 3 days prior to your treatment (unless medically contraindicated):
○ Alcoholic beverages
○ NSAIDs (Advil/Ibuprofen/Aspirin)
○ Warfarin
○ Herbal supplements: Vitamin E, St. John’s Wort, Garlic, Ginkgo, Ginseng
○ Any supplements or medication that increases the chances of blood thinning
